An Inverse Boundary Value Problem for the Heat Equation: the Neumann Condition

open access: yes, 2007
We consider the inverse problem to determine the shape of an insulated inclusion within a heat conducting medium from overdetermined Cauchy data of solutions for the heat equation on the accessible exterior boundary of the medium.

Multilayered Digital Microfluidic Chip for Cell‐Based Assays

open access: yesAdvanced Materials Interfaces, EarlyView.
A multilayered digital microfluidic (mDMF) chip architecture is introduced to improve throughput and robustness in cell‐based assays. By multilayering electrode components and dielectric layers on glass, this design significantly reduces actuation voltage, maintains reliability, and enables expansion of the operational area with minimum current leakage.

An Inverse Boundary Value Problem for the Inhomogeneous Porous Medium Equation

open access: yesSIAM Journal on Applied Mathematics
In this paper we establish uniqueness in the inverse boundary value problem for the two coefficients in the inhomogeneous porous medium equation $ε\partial_tu-\nabla\cdot(γ\nabla u^m)=0$, with $m>1$, in dimension 3 or higher, which is a degenerate parabolic type quasilinear PDE.
